Renaissance Period
The Renaissance period covers 1300 to 11600 AD.
Renaissance literally means “rebirth”, it refers to the rebirth of learning that
began in Italy spreading to England and back to Italy.
There was an enormous renewal of interest in and study of classical antiquity.
The Renaissance Period saw the cultivation of a vocal polyphony that has
never been surpassed.
Referred sometimes as the “Golden Age of Polyphony”

Significant Breakthroughs in Science
Copernicus (1473-1543) attempted to prove that the sun rather than
the earth was at the center of the planetary system.
Galileo Galilei discovered some of the moons of Jupiter.
Significant Breakthroughs in Religion
Martin Luther (1483-1546) challenged and ultimately caused the
division of one of the major institutions that had united Europe
throughout the Middle Ages – the Church

Significant Breakthroughs in Technology
Music printing was discovered.
Ottaviano Petrucci of Venice published the first printed music.
